The most critical difference for students is that between the two editions. A "Chapter 4, Problem 15" in the Global Edition might be a different problem than the one in the US Edition. Therefore, it is essential to use a solution manual that specifically matches the Global Edition of your textbook to ensure you are working on the correct exercises.
